My dealer tells me that a new WRX needs servicing every 10k miles and an STi every 7.5k. He says there are 3 levels of service that cost c.£150, £250, and £400. So over 30k miles or 3 years the total service bill would be under a grand.
What Car show the service bill to be £2500.
Who is telling the truth?
How would the STi costs vary, esp if an EU import, I gather the service intervals are different?

New MY02 UK Purchased WRX and STI Impreza's have a 10,000 mile service interval. Older cars have a 7500 mile service interval.

However, it's many people's opinion on here that the 10,000 mile service is too long for the STI and most people change the oil at 5000 miles.
